Chapter 727 Acting Fast

When Leanna returned to her studio, it was already close to noon.

Just as she entered the office, Zoe approached her with a suggestive tone. "Where's your Mr. Pearson?"

"He went to Crossley Group to deal with the follow-up collaborations," Leanna replied.

Seated across from her, Zoe arched an eyebrow and inquired, "Didn't you two have any plans for a date or something today?"

Leanna flipped open her notepad and replied, "A date? In the middle of the day? I've got a heap of piled-up work waiting to be done."

"How can it be the same? Didn't you two register for marriage today?"

Leanna remained silent for a moment before asking, "How did you know?"

"It's all over the internet," Zoe replied, pointing at her phone.

Curious, Leanna picked up her phone and started scrolling through its content.

The photos were taken from the side and back of her and Aidan. Although the pictures were slightly blurry, it was still possible to make out their identities.

There was a photo of them taken on the steps of the Civil Affairs Bureau after they obtained their marriage certificate.

The warm and radiant sunlight was ascending behind them. In the photo, she wore a beaming smile on her face, while Aidan tilted his head to gaze at her as his lips curved into a gentle smile.

As Leanna found the photo was nicely taken, she decided to keep it saved on her phone.

"The last time I saw you smiling so happily was when you got divorced," Zoe commented, her voice tinged with nostalgia.

At once, Leanna was rendered speechless.

How rare it is to see Zoe and Aidan on the same page about this.

After contemplating for a moment, she questioned, "Was I truly happy when I got divorced?"

Zoe rested her chin on her hand as she recalled. "You were all smiles, but it was more like a huge weight off your shoulders. At that time, you were filled with anticipation for the future, clearly exhausted and done with your old life."
